在电影院的英语对话1
Tom: Do you go to the cinema a lot Martin?
Martin: I used to quite often, Tom, but lately I just haven't found the time or the cinemas around here aren't quite as big here.
Tom: So, I guess you've had time to contemplate on it. What's your favorite movie of all time?
Martin: Well, my favorite movie, and the best movie I've ever seen would have to be Seven Samurai, the story about a *** all peasant village in Japan, hired in Seven Samurai to protect it and the ensuing struggles that the villagers had with the samurai, and the Samurai did with themselves and then the final fight that they has with the bandits that were trying to take the peasants grain. It's a magnificent story.
Tom: It's a classic. It's black and white, right?
Martin: Yes, it is. It was made by the Japanese director Akira Kurasawa. I think it was 1956 or 57, but it's affected so many other movies, Tom. I mean if you look at the Magnificent Seven, the Western, it's modeled directly after that, as well as some other modern movies that you might not think as much about. Roger Corman's, Battle Beyond the Stars with George Peppard Are you serious? was modeled straight off of Seven Samurai, and even Bug's Life.
Tom: Wow. Now that I think of that I can see that.
Martin: Yeah, it's a really important movie. How about you Tom? What's your favorite movie of all time?
Tom: I don't know about of old time, but recently, and don't laugh when I say this, Pirates of the Caribbean was an absolute masterpiece. I saw the trailer so many times in the cinema and just thought it was going to be rubbish, but when I eventually got around to seeing it, it was full of good jokes and it was Jonny Depp as a pirate going around the Caribbean. There was a ghost story. There was a love story in it. There was a young man who'd run away to join the Pirate's. The whole thing was just action packed, funny and colorful. It was a really entertaining movie.
Martin: Yeah, I would agree with you Tom. It was very fun and Johnny Depp was great, modelling Keith Richards as a pirate. I think that...
Tom: Well, I heard that he was modelling the original ride at Disneyland.
Martin: Oh, really.
Tom: The mechanical models jerking around on the pirate ship, the mannequins, I heard that was what he modeled his character on.
Martin: I heard he modeled after Keith Richards.
Tom: He's the kind of actor who es up with a different story at every interview.
Martin: Well, I guess that's why he's acting.

英语口语:电影评价
1.That movie we saw last night was very boring, wasn't it?
我们昨晚看的那部电影真没劲,不是吗?
2.It's said that the movie is a box-office hit.
据说那部电影很卖座。
3.That movie he starred is a blockbuster.
他主演的那部电影很火。
4.What do you think of the new film?
你认为那部新电影怎么样?
5. think that movie is boring.
我认为那场电影很无聊。
6.The film you recommended is really worth watching.
你推荐的这部电影真的很值得看。
7.The new thriller is a real eye-popper.
这部新惊悚电影令人大饱眼福。
8.This new love film has evoked general approval.
这部新的爱情影片赢得了大众的认可。
9.He performed the role well.
他这个角色演得不错。
10.These old films are wonderful.
这些老片非常好看。
11.I’ve been opposed to attract the audience by nakedness.
我一直反对靠裸露来吸引票房的。
12.Keep the children away from those crime dramas.
不要让孩子们看那些犯罪片。
13.The movie has been hyped up far beyond its worth.
这部影片被吹得太离谱了。
14.We were deeply touched by the sentimental story that the movie told.
我们深深被那部电影讲述的伤感 故事 所感动。
15.It is the most popular independent French movie ever made.
这部电影是最受欢迎的独立制作的法国电影。
16.I think the film does have some positive effect.
我认为这电影的确有些积极影响。
17.That was undoubtedly the best film I've seen all year.
那无疑是我全年中所看过的最好的一部电影。
英语口语:电影介绍
1.I heard that Black Hawk Down is a war film, isn’t it?
我听说《黑鹰坠落》是一部战争片,是吗?
2.Is the movie starred by Jet Lee?
这部电影是李连杰主演的吗?
3.This new film is said to be adapted from a classic novel.
据说这部新影片是根据一本经典小说改编的。
4.The cast of the play includes many famous actors.
这个剧的演员名单中有许多名演员。
5.There is an interesting film on Channel Two.
在2频道有一部有趣的电影。
6.Do you know who is in this movie?
你知道这部电影是谁演的?
7.I wouldn't go to see it if I had known who starred in that film.
如果我知道那部影片是谁主演的我就不会去看了。
英语口语:在电影院
1.When does the film begin?
电影什么时候开始?
2.What's on tomorrow evening?
明天晚上放什么电影?
(也可以这样说:What's playing tomorrow evening?)
3.What time will the movie be over?
几点演完?
(也可以这样说:What time will the movie end?)
4.How long does the movie last?
演多长时间?
(也可以这样说:How long will the movie last?
How long is the movie? )
5.You are in the back of the cinema, aren’t you?
你们坐在电影院的后面,是吗?
6.I can't see the screen because of the person in front of me.
前边的人挡着,我看不见银幕。
(也可以这样说:That person is blocking my view.
That person is in my way. )
7.Let's sit in the front of the cinema.
我们坐到影院的前面吧。
8.What time is the showing of the film you want to see?
你想看的那场电影几点开演?
(也可以这样说:When is the showing of the film you want to see?)
9.I groped my way to a seat in the dim cinema.
我在昏暗的电影院里摸索着找一个座位。
10.The movie hadn't yet begun by the time we got there.
当我们到那儿的时候,电影还没有开始。
11.The movie started at seven and ended at half past nine.
电影从7点开始放映到9点半结束。
12.He was on edge of his seat through the action movie.
他从头到尾一口气都没松看完了那部动作电影。
13.They've got Star Wars on.
电影院正上演《星球大战》。
14.They are showing Titanic.
《泰坦尼克号》正在上演。
15.The popcom has become a staple at movie theaters nowadays.
如今爆米花成了影剧院内的主要商品。
